Labour Leaders Confirm Port Harcourt Refinery is Now Operational (Video)

Labour Leaders Confirm Port Harcourt Refinery is Now Operational (Video)-OXYGIST

Nigerian Labour Congress (NLC) and Trade Union Congress (TUC) leaders have officially confirmed that the Port Harcourt refinery is operational, putting to rest lingering debates about its functionality.


During a facility tour, union leaders from the NLC, TUC, NUPENG, and PENGASSAN evaluated the refinery’s operations. Their visit aimed to provide firsthand insights into its status amid public skepticism.


The Executive Vice President Downstream of the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ited (NNPCL) briefed the delegation, announcing that the new Port Harcourt refinery project is 90% complete.


Amid ongoing conversations about the refinery's future, labour leaders have strongly opposed its privatization. Instead, they recommended adopting the NLNG model, which involves a partnership between the federal government and international oil companies for effective management.


The operational status of the Port Harcourt refinery has sparked widespread debate, with some questioning its readiness. However, this visit and confirmation by key union representatives provide clarity and reassurance.
